In my opinion, endlessly sitting in front of YouTube watching Photoshop tutorials on how to master Compositing skills isn’t inspiring, and I frequently find myself faced with a Creative Block.
Here’s been my experience in the 4 short months of becoming a Composite Photographer.
The first few months were spent consuming every FREE Photoshop Tutorial I could find on Compositing and photo manipulation, which resulted in me spending the next few months working and overworking my photography in Photoshop.
With each Composite I created, I grew in my understanding of the various elements of Compositing, and I’ve learned that the real ART of Composite Photography is CONTROLLING the medium.
As I’ve grown in my Compositing skills, and I’ll be the first to admit I have a lot more growing to do, I’ve found myself transitioning my attention from the technical application of Compositing to the creative elements of a dynamic Composite.
Great Composite Photography requires great technique and great vision.
The Composite Photographers I highlight in my video have all developed amazing Composites because they have managed to marry great technique with a great vision.
